Today is Endangered Species Day, and we’re celebrating the 50th anniversary of the Endangered Species Act, a landmark piece of legislation marking our commitment to the conservation of animals, plants, and wildlife, and of the ecosystems they call home, like coral reefs. The hawksbill turtle in today’s photo is one reef local in critical danger, and one of critical importance to coral ecosystem health, thought to have supported our seas for the last 100 million years.
